I went to Depeche Mode at MSG in NYC Wed Oct 28th 1998. Great on stage performance, combined with a very enthusiastic and energetic crowd! BTW, always observe all signs at all times. :)
I must say that out
of all the concerts I've ever been to, this one was one of the most enjoyable
of all times. Of all the favorite bands of mine i've ever wanted
to see this was amongst the most important band! Although the Sisters
of Mercy had a better light show, DM had unbelievable stage presence, great
vocals, and great movement on stage. The big "DM" behind them and
the funky lights around the upper tier of the stage were impressive!
Some new remixes of some old songs...and an unbelievable version of "Somebody"
sang old 80's DM style! :) Fans seemed in their mid twenties
to late thirties overall, and was a very tame crowd. Also, i've seem
many bands try to get the crowd to swing their arms...but of them all,
DM had the crowd swinging their arms so much it looked awesome (by far
topped the Chili Peppers try at Woodstock 94!). I can't say it any
other way. There was a "mood" and a feeling in that place that not
even words could describe. DM had and will always have a great stage
show. Check em out if they ever tour again!
